jQuery插件有哪些

介绍

这篇文章主要介绍jQuery插件有哪些,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!

<强> jQuery插件就是一些人用jQuery写的一些工具,我们在调用时只需要用很少的代码就能实现很好的效果,编写jQuery插件的目的主要是给已经有的一系列方法或函数做一个封装,以便在其他地方重复使用,方便后期维护和提高开发效率。

<强>让我们来看一下,一些常用的jQuery插件:

<强> jQuery表单验证插件:验证

最常使用JavScript的场合就是表单的验证,而jQuery作为一个优秀的JavaScript库,也提供了一个优秀的表单验证插件——验证。jQuery验证是历史最悠久的插件之一,经过了全球范围内不同项目的验证,并得到了许多Web开发者的好评。作为一个标准的验证方法库,

<强>验证拥有如下优点:

内置验证规则:拥有必填,数字、电子邮件、网址和信用卡号码等19类内置验证规则

自定义验证规则:可以很方便地自定义验证规则

简单强大的验证信息提示:默认了验证信息提示,并提供自定义覆盖默认提示信息的功能

实时验证:可以通过按键弹起或模糊事件触发验证,而不仅仅在表单提交的时候验证。

<强> jQuery表单插件:形式

jQuery形式插件是一个优秀的Ajax表单插件,可以非常容易地,无侵入地升级HTML表单以支持Ajax.jQuery有两个核心方法——ajaxForm()和ajaxSubmit(),它们集合了从控制表单元素到决定如何管理提交进程的功能。另外iain,

<>强插件还包括其他的一些方法:

formToArray (), formSerialize (), fieldSerialize (), fieldValue (), clearForm()和resetForm()等

<强> jQuery UI插件

jQuery UI源自于一个jQuery插件——Interface.Interface插件最早版本我1.2,只支持jQuery1.1.2的版本,后来有人对界面的大部分代表基于jQuery1.2的API进行重构,并统一了API。由于改进重大,因此版本号不是1.3而是直接跳到1.5,并且改名为jQuery UI。

<强> jQuery UI主要分为3个部分,交互,微件和效果库

<强>交互。这里都是一些与鼠标交互相关的内容。包括拖动,置放,缩放,选择和排序等待。微件(Widget)中有部分是基于这些交互组建来制作的。此库需要一个jQuery UI核心库——ui.core。js支持

<强>微件。这里主要是一些界面的扩展。里边包括了手风琴导航,自动完成,取色器,对话框、滑块、标签,日历,放大镜,进度条和微调控制器等待。此库需要一个jQuery UI核心库——ui.core.js支持

<>强效果库。此库用于提供丰富的动画效果,让动画不再局限于动画()方法。效果库有自己的一套核心即effects.core.js,无需jQuery的核心库ui.core。js支持

<强>动态绑定事件插件:livequery

查询的事件绑定功能使得jQuery代码与HTML代码能够完全分离,这样代码的层次关系更加清晰,维护起来也更加简单,然而对于动态加载到页面的HTML元素,每次都需要重新绑定事件到这些元素上,十分不便。

一款新的插件由此产生,即livequery,可以利用它给相应的DOM元素注册时间或者触发回调函数函数。不仅当前选择器匹配的元素会被绑定事件,而且后来通过JavaScript添加的元素都会被绑定事件。当元素不再和选择器匹配时,livequery会自动取消事件注册,使得开发者不再需要关注HTML元素的来源,只需要关注如何编写其绑定的事件即可。

通过jQuery选择器选择一个DOM元素,livequery插件会实时地在整个DOM范围将其持久化。这意味着无论元素是先前存在的还是后来动态加载的,事件都会被绑定,就像是CSS给元素添加样式一样,同时,这款插件几乎在没占用什么资源的情况下就做到了这些功能。

以上是“jQuery插件有哪些”这篇文章的所有内容,感谢各位的阅读!希望分享的内容对大家有帮助,更多相关知识,欢迎关注行业资讯频道!

jQuery插件有哪些